Porady: deklarowanie stałej (Visual Basic)

Za pomocą Const instrukcji, aby zadeklarować stałą i ustawić jej wartość.Oświadczając, stałą, opisową nazwę przypisać wartość.Po stała jest zadeklarowana, nie modyfikowane lub przypisane nową wartość.

Można zadeklarować stałą w ramach procedury lub w sekcji deklaracji modułu, klasy lub struktury.Klasy lub struktury poziomu stałych są Private domyślnie, ale może również być zadeklarowany jako Public, Friend, Protected, lub Protected Friend na odpowiedni poziom dostępu do kodu.

Stała musi być prawidłową nazwą symboliczną (zasady są takie same jak do tworzenia nazw zmiennych) i wyrażenie składa liczbą lub ciągiem stałe i operatory (ale nie wywołania funkcji).

[!UWAGA]

Na komputerze w poniższych instrukcjach mogą być wyświetlane inne nazwy i lokalizacje niektórych elementów interfejsu użytkownika programu Visual Studio. Te elementy są określane przez numer wersji Visual Studio oraz twoje ustawienia. Aby uzyskać więcej informacji, zobacz Dostosowywanie ustawień środowiska deweloperskiego w Visual Studio.

Aby zadeklarować stałą

  • Napisać deklaracji, że obejmuje specyfikatora dostępu Const słowa kluczowego i wyrażenia, jak w poniższych przykładach:

    Public Const DaysInYear = 365
    Private Const WorkDays = 250
    

    When Option Infer is Off and Option Strict is On, you must declare a constant explicitly by specifying a data type (Boolean, Byte, Char, DateTime, Decimal, Double, Integer, Long, Short, Single, or String).

    Gdy Option Infer jest On lub Option Strict jest Off, można zadeklarować stałą, bez określania typu danych z As klauzuli.Kompilator określa typ stała z typu wyrażenia.Aby uzyskać więcej informacji, zobacz Stała i typy literałów (Visual Basic).

Aby zadeklarować stałą, która ma typ danych jawnie podane

  • Deklaracja, która zawiera zapis As wpisz słowo kluczowe i jawne dane, jak w poniższych przykładach:

    Public Const MyInteger As Integer = 42
    Private Const DaysInWeek As Short = 7
    Protected Friend Const Funday As String = "Sunday"
    

    Można deklarować stałe wielu w jednym wierszu, mimo że kod jest bardziej czytelny zadeklarować pojedynczej stałej na wiersz.Przy deklarowaniu wielu stałych w pojedynczym wierszu takie muszą mieć ten sam poziom dostępu (Public, Private, Friend, Protected, lub Protected Friend).

Aby zadeklarować wielu stałych w jednym wierszu

  • Deklaracje należy oddzielić przecinkiem i spacją, jak w poniższym przykładzie:

    Public Const Four As Integer = 4, Five As Integer = 5, Six As Integer = 44
    

Zobacz też

Zadania

Porady: deklarowanie wyliczeń (Visual Basic)

Informacje

Const — Instrukcja (Visual Basic)

Option Strict — Instrukcja

Koncepcje

Stała i typy literałów (Visual Basic)

Enumerations — Przegląd (Visual Basic)

Stałe — Przegląd (Visual Basic)

Wyliczenie i kwantyfikacja nazwy (Visual Basic)

Stałe i wyliczenia (Visual Basic)

Inne zasoby

Stałe i wyliczenia w Visual Basic